How Making a Difference: Taking A Closer Look at Howard County Sheriff's Youth Programs Actually Works
At the core, Making a Difference: Taking A Closer Look at Howard County Sheriff's Youth Programs is designed to connect young people with positive adult influences. Participants often engage in activities that blend classroom learning with hands-on experiences. Topics may include communication skills, problem solving, physical fitness, and basic understanding of public service roles. The intent is to provide a safe space where curiosity is encouraged and questions are welcomed without judgment. Structured routines help participants build discipline while still allowing room for creativity and personal expression.
A typical program might include group projects, such as organizing neighborhood clean-ups or planning community events. These activities are framed as opportunities to practice leadership and cooperation in concrete ways. Mentors guide participants through decision making scenarios that mimic real life without real world consequences. For example, a scenario might involve resolving a disagreement between teammates or planning a small fundraiser with a limited budget. By working through these exercises, young people gain exposure to critical thinking and collaboration in a supportive environment.

Things People Often Misunderstand
One common misunderstanding is that Making a Difference: Taking A Closer Look at Howard County Sheriff's Youth Programs are exclusively intended for youth who are already interested in law enforcement careers. In reality, the curriculum is usually designed to be broad and applicable to many life paths. Activities focus on universal skills such as listening, collaboration, and responsible decision making. Another misconception is that these programs are informal gatherings without clear structure. In fact, most operate under defined guidelines, with scheduled meetings, learning objectives, and assessment methods to track participant growth.
Some people may assume that participation automatically leads to specific career outcomes or preferential treatment in future opportunities. While the experience can certainly build a resume and confidence, it does not guarantee positions or special considerations. The real value often lies in the development of character, resilience, and a sense of civic awareness.
